so i have been really struggling with the studio grey skin and had a chat with my wife about the skin color.
we finally decided on going for the pale skin but since the triad from reaper only limits you to a base shade highlight i decided to start with tanned skin -> tanned highlight -> fair shadow -> fair skin -> fair highlight this gives a nice deep shadow and i hope that, the purple hue in in tanned skin comes out nicely.
